Have gotten success with a dataset that failed before with ff 10.

End result:

mdstash=# select * from pgstathashindex('link_datum_id_idx');
version | bucket_pages | overflow_pages | bitmap_pages | unused_pages | live_items | dead_items | free_percent
---------+--------------+----------------+--------------+--------------+------------+------------+------------------
4 | 12391325 | 5148912 | 158 | 191643 | 4560007478 | 0 | 1894.29056075982
(1 row)

mdstash=# select 5148912.0/158/8;
?column?
-----------------------
4073.5063291139240000
(1 row)

The index is 135GB rather than 900GB (from memory/give or take).

I'm happy so far. I'll be seeing how much more I can dump into it this weekend. :)
